Q: Is 13,608,606 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 13,608,606 is a composite number.

Why is 13,608,606 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 13,608,606 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 11 22 33 66 206,191 412,382 618,573 1,237,146 2,268,101 4,536,202 6,804,303 and 13,608,606, with no remainder.

Since 13,608,606 cannot be divided by just 1 and 13,608,606, it is a composite number.
